Demystifying IPASN: Your Ultimate Guide
Hey there, tech enthusiasts! Ever heard of IPASN? If you're knee-deep in the world of networking, cybersecurity, or even just curious about how the internet works, then this article is for you. We're diving deep into the fascinating world of IPASN, breaking down what it is, how it functions, and why it matters. Get ready to level up your knowledge, guys!
What is IPASN, Exactly?
Alright, let's start with the basics. IPASN, which stands for IP Address to Autonomous System Number, is essentially a tool that maps IP addresses to the Autonomous System (AS) they belong to. Think of an AS as a large network operated by a single entity, like an Internet Service Provider (ISP), a university, or a major corporation. Each AS has a unique number, the ASN, which is used for routing traffic across the internet. The IPASN database provides a way to look up the ASN associated with a given IP address. It's like a phone book for the internet, but instead of connecting people, it connects IP addresses to the networks that manage them.
Now, why is this information so valuable? Well, it's used for a whole bunch of things, including network monitoring, security analysis, and even geographical analysis. Knowing the ASN of an IP address can help you determine the origin of network traffic, identify potential security threats, and understand the overall structure of the internet. IPASN is a key resource for network administrators, security professionals, and anyone who needs to understand the relationships between IP addresses and the networks they operate on. Furthermore, IPASN data can be incredibly useful for geographical analysis. By mapping IP addresses to their corresponding ASNs, we can infer the physical location of a network. This is useful in various contexts like content delivery optimization, digital marketing, and cybercrime investigation. This ability to link IP addresses to ASNs allows us to glean insights into where online activities originate. Ultimately, IPASN is a core component of how we understand and navigate the complexities of the internet.
Breaking Down the Components
Let's break down the components of IPASN for clarity. First off, we have IP Addresses. These are the unique numerical labels that identify devices connected to a network that uses the Internet Protocol for communication. Then, we have the Autonomous System (AS). An AS is a large network or group of networks under a single administrative control. Think of it as a domain on the internet where routing is managed by a single entity. The Autonomous System Number (ASN) is a globally unique identifier assigned to each AS. It allows the internet to route traffic efficiently. It is crucial for routing traffic across the internet. Lastly, IPASN databases compile and maintain the mappings between IP addresses and ASNs. This database is constantly updated to reflect changes in IP address allocations and AS infrastructure. IPASN databases are essentially comprehensive records, helping users to translate an IP address into its corresponding ASN quickly and efficiently.
By understanding these components, you begin to grasp the purpose and power of IPASN. This data is regularly used by security professionals for threat intelligence, network administrators for optimizing traffic, and marketers for geo-targeting. IPASN gives a detailed view of the infrastructure behind the internet.
How Does IPASN Work?
So, how does this magic happen? Well, it all starts with the IP address. When you send or receive data over the internet, your device uses an IP address. This IP address is then used to route your data to its destination. The IPASN database then takes this IP address and looks up the corresponding ASN. The database is continually updated with new information to accommodate changes in the internet's structure, so it is accurate. This process involves several key players and processes. Let's dig in.
The Role of Databases and Data Sources
At the core of IPASN functionality lies the IPASN database. These databases are essentially massive tables that store the associations between IP addresses and ASNs. These databases are built and maintained by various organizations, including Regional Internet Registries (RIRs) and commercial data providers. RIRs, like ARIN (for North America) and RIPE NCC (for Europe, the Middle East, and Central Asia), are responsible for allocating and managing IP addresses within their respective regions. They are key contributors to IPASN data. Commercial providers gather data from multiple sources. They have a more comprehensive view of the internet's structure. These organizations collect data from a variety of sources. This data is critical to keeping the databases up-to-date.
The data sources include:
- Routing Information: BGP (Border Gateway Protocol) is a crucial protocol that allows ASNs to exchange routing information. This information is a critical input to IPASN databases. These updates are crucial for the dynamic nature of the internet.
 - Whois Data: Whois records provide information about IP address allocations. They include the ASNs assigned to specific IP address blocks. They also ensure the accuracy of IPASN data.
 - DNS Data: Domain Name System (DNS) records can also provide clues about network ownership and affiliation. DNS can aid in identifying the AS associated with an IP address.
 
These different data sources are processed and integrated into the IPASN database. This results in the final product: a complete map of IP addresses to their respective ASNs. Data from these sources are aggregated, cleaned, and validated to ensure data quality and reliability. Regular updates ensure the databases reflect the current state of the internet.
The Lookup Process
Now, let's get into the nitty-gritty of the lookup process. When you want to find the ASN for an IP address, you initiate a lookup request. This request is typically sent to an IPASN database or a service that provides IPASN information. Here's a breakdown of the steps involved:
- Input: You provide the IP address you want to look up.
 - Query: The system queries the IPASN database using the IP address as the search key.
 - Matching: The database searches for a matching entry in its records.
 - Retrieval: If a match is found, the system retrieves the corresponding ASN.
 - Output: The system returns the ASN, along with other relevant information. This might include the AS's name, country, and other details.
 
This whole process usually takes only a few milliseconds, making it a super-fast and efficient tool for network analysis. This is the basic workflow for accessing IPASN information.
Why is IPASN Important?
Alright, so we know what IPASN is and how it works. But why should you care? The truth is, IPASN is incredibly important for a wide range of reasons, including:
Security and Network Monitoring
For security professionals, IPASN is a game-changer. It helps identify the source of network traffic and potential threats. By knowing the ASN of an IP address, you can trace malicious activity back to its origin. You can also analyze traffic patterns to detect suspicious behavior. IPASN helps identify the AS associated with malicious IPs, enabling faster incident response. This is essential for protecting networks and data from cyberattacks. It enables security teams to quickly identify and respond to threats.
Geolocation and Content Delivery
IPASN is also crucial for geolocation. By mapping IP addresses to ASNs, you can infer the approximate geographical location of a user or device. This is used for a variety of purposes, including content delivery optimization, digital marketing, and fraud prevention. Content Delivery Networks (CDNs) use IPASN to direct users to the nearest server. Digital marketers use it to target ads based on location. Fraud detection systems use it to identify suspicious transactions. It's a key component in providing personalized and optimized online experiences.
Network Troubleshooting and Optimization
Network administrators use IPASN to diagnose and resolve network issues. By knowing the ASN of an IP address, they can identify the network responsible for a problem. This helps speed up the troubleshooting process and improve network performance. Network administrators can also use IPASN to optimize routing and improve network efficiency. It is also used to find bottlenecks and optimize traffic flow.
Compliance and Legal Purposes
IPASN data can be used for compliance and legal purposes. For example, it can help identify the jurisdiction of an IP address. This is important for compliance with data privacy regulations. IPASN is also used in investigations. It enables law enforcement to trace the source of online activity. IPASN provides valuable information for legal and regulatory purposes.
Tools and Resources for Using IPASN
So, you're excited to start using IPASN? Fantastic! Luckily, there are a bunch of tools and resources available to help you get started:
Online Lookup Tools
There are numerous online tools that allow you to quickly look up the ASN for a given IP address. These tools typically provide a simple interface where you enter the IP address and get the ASN instantly. Some popular options include:
- IPWHOIS: A simple and user-friendly tool that provides IP information.
 - MaxMind: Offers a range of IP intelligence solutions.
 - IP2ASN: Provides fast and accurate IP to ASN lookups.
 
These tools are great for quick lookups and for getting a general overview of an IP address's associated network.
API Services
If you need to integrate IPASN data into your applications or workflows, you can use API services. These APIs allow you to programmatically access IPASN data and integrate it into your systems. Some popular API providers include:
- IPinfo: Offers a comprehensive IP geolocation and ASN API.
 - DigitalOcean: Provides an IP to ASN API as part of its cloud services.
 - BigDataCloud: Provides a variety of IP intelligence APIs.
 
These APIs are perfect for developers who need to automate IPASN lookups or integrate them into their applications.
Databases and Data Feeds
For those who need to work with large datasets or require offline access, there are databases and data feeds that provide IPASN information. These resources allow you to download and store IPASN data locally. Some common options include:
- RIRs: Regional Internet Registries provide access to their data.
 - Commercial Data Providers: MaxMind, IPinfo, and others also offer downloadable databases.
 
These databases and data feeds are excellent for users who need to analyze IPASN data on a large scale or require offline access.
Conclusion: The Power of IPASN
So there you have it, guys! We've covered the basics of IPASN, including what it is, how it works, and why it's so important. From network security to geolocation and network optimization, IPASN plays a critical role in the digital world. By understanding IPASN, you can gain valuable insights into the internet's structure and behavior. Whether you're a network administrator, security professional, or simply a curious tech enthusiast, IPASN is a tool that can help you navigate the complexities of the internet with greater understanding and efficiency. So, go forth and explore the fascinating world of IPASN! You are now equipped with the knowledge to understand and utilize IPASN. Stay curious, keep learning, and keep exploring the amazing world of technology! Thanks for tuning in! Keep an eye out for more tech breakdowns. Until next time! Peace out!